The real-world Scania V8 engine, first introduced in 1969 , is a 16.4-liter powerhouse. In its most modern 770S configuration , it produces 770 horsepower and 3,500 Nm of torque. With the release of ETS2 1.45, the game continued to utilize the sound engine, allowing modders to implement complex audio behaviors such as directional sound, exhaust resonance, and turbo whine.
